Lopez Family Foundation Honored By ATA, Receives $50,000 Donation

Jennifer Lopez and The Lopez Family Foundation have been named the winners of the 2013 American Telemedicine Association (ATA) Humanitarian Award!

In a video statement that will be shown at the ATA conference in May, Jennifer said she was honored to receive the Humanitarian Award from the ATA and has seen the positive impact of telemedicine in improving patients’ health and wellbeing.

In honor of the award, Joel E. Barthelemy, Founder and Managing Director of GlobalMed, a worldwide leader in real-time healthcare delivery systems, presented Jennifer with a $50,000 check towards the Lopez Family Foundation.

Jennifer and her sister, Lynda Lopez, started the foundation to improve access to quality healthcare and health education to women and children living in underserved and underprivileged communities. The goals of the foundation include expanding the number of telemedicine clinics domestically and abroad to increase “access to top quality pediatric care for the most serious cases.”

Barthelemy said he is glad to be able to support a cause that is helping provide much-needed access to healthcare in places with the greatest need.

“The Lopez Family Foundation is an amazing organization that is giving the opportunity for quality healthcare to families and children in areas that need it the most,” Barthelemy said. “We are proud to be able to support this effort and help build on the foundation’s goals.”

‘The Fosters’ Premiere Date Set

ABC Family’s new original series “The Fosters”, which is executive produced by Jennifer Lopez has a premiere date! It will premiere on Monday, June 3rd, at 9:00 – 10:00 p.m. ET/PT, following the series finale of “The Secret Life of the American Teenager.” The one-hour drama centers on two moms (Teri Polo and Sherri Saum) raising a multi-ethnic family mix of foster and biological kids. The series also stars Jake T. Austin, Hayden Byerly, David Lambert, Maia Mitchell, Danny Nucci and Cierra Ramirez.

Music update

Seems like Jennifer is working hard on new music lately!
After the news that she hit the studio with Afrojack, Dr Luke and Sean Paul it seems like she recorded some new music this week.

Chantal Kreviazuk tweeted the following and Jennifer replied:

Chantal is a singer-songwriter, she penned songs for the likes of Avril Lavigne, Gwen Stefani, Kelly Clarkson, Carrie Underwood and Drake.

A day after Jennifer tweeted something really exciting for us long time LOVE!rs:

Cory and Jennifer have quite some musical history together as he (co-)wrote and produced lots of Jen’s musical catalog. They collaborated on JLo signature songs like If You Had My Love, Ain’t It Funny, I’m Real, Play, Jenny From The Block, All I Have, Get Right, Do It Well and Hold It, Don’t Drop It. The song dedicated to Jennifer’s twins Max and Emme, One Step At A Time, was their latest track together.
